クラスバイト

java.lang.ObjectSE
org.springframework.security.web.webauthn.api.Bytes
実装されているすべてのインターフェース:
SerializableSE

public final class Bytes extends ObjectSE implements SerializableSE
byte[] のオブジェクト表現。
導入:
6.4
関連事項:
  • コンストラクターの概要

    コンストラクター
    コンストラクター
    説明
    Bytes(byte[] bytes)
    新しいインスタンスを作成します
  • メソッドのサマリー

    修飾子と型
    メソッド
    説明
    boolean
    static Bytes
    fromBase64(@Nullable StringSE base64UrlString)
    base64 URL 文字列から新しいインスタンスを作成します。
    byte[]
    生のバイトを取得します。
    int
    static Bytes
    ランダムバイトと十分なエントロピーを持つ安全なランダム Bytes を作成します。
    バイトを Base64 URL エンコードされた文字列として取得します。

    クラス java.lang.ObjectSE から継承されたメソッド

    clone, finalize, getClass, notify, notifyAll, wait, waitSE, waitSE
  • コンストラクターの詳細

    • Bytes

      public Bytes(byte[] bytes)
      新しいインスタンスを作成します
      パラメーター:
      bytes - エンコードされる生の base64UrlString。
  • メソッドの詳細

    • getBytes

      public byte[] getBytes()
      生のバイトを取得します。
      戻り値:
      バイト
    • toBase64UrlString

      public StringSE toBase64UrlString()
      バイトを Base64 URL エンコードされた文字列として取得します。
      戻り値:
    • equals

      public boolean equals(ObjectSE obj)
      オーバーライド:
      クラス ObjectSEequalsSE 
    • hashCode

      public int hashCode()
      オーバーライド:
      クラス ObjectSEhashCode 
    • toString

      public StringSE toString()
      オーバーライド:
      クラス ObjectSEtoString 
    • random

      public static Bytes random()
      ランダムバイトと十分なエントロピーを持つ安全なランダム Bytes を作成します。
      戻り値:
      新しい安全なランダム生成 Bytes
    • fromBase64

      public static Bytes fromBase64(@Nullable StringSE base64UrlString)
      base64 URL 文字列から新しいインスタンスを作成します。
      パラメーター:
      base64UrlString - base64 URL 文字列
      戻り値:
      Bytes